HOW EARLY CAN I EXPECT TO FIND MY BABY’S HEARTBEAT?
BABY DOPPLER RENTAL CANADA - FETAL ASSUREIn most cases, fetal heartbeats can be detected between 10-12 weeks. In more rare cases, they can be found as early as 8-9 weeks. However, it is recommended that most women wait until the 10-12 week range since it can be very difficult to locate the fetal heartbeat earlier.

Are baby heartbeat monitors safe?
Baby Heartbeat Monitor - FAQ's - Sweet Beats.netThe FDA regulates Fetal Doppler ultrasound. No harmful effects on the fetus have ever been reported. The Mayo Clinic says "In 30 years of regular use, no adverse effects have ever been demonstrated from ultrasound testing. Research has been done investigating both the noise produced in utero and the heat produced by ultrasound, and no problems have ever been detected from its use in exposed babies.
What if I don't hear my baby's heartbeat?
Baby Heartbeat Monitor - FAQ's - Sweet Beats.netThe first rule is don't panic. There are many factors you first need to take into consideration. First, how far into your pregnancy are you? By 14 weeks 100% of healthy pregnancies will be able to locate the fetal heartbeat with a baby heartbeat monitor. So if your pregnancy is somewhere between 8-14 weeks you'll just have to be patient. The baby may be in a position where hearing the heartbeat is difficult.
What if my baby is born early?
BRMH | FAQA baby is considered full term if it is born at 38 weeks in gestation or more. Babies born between 35 and 38 weeks may have some breathing or feeding problems but can be cared for by the hospital’s experienced staff. If you are in preterm labor (labor before 35 weeks of your pregnancy) your doctor may recommend that you be transferred to a larger center in case more care is needed for your baby.
What is Doppler?
AO-40 FAQDoppler is the change of frequency that occurs when an object (such as a spacecraft) has motion relative to you. It manifests itself as the frequency of a received signal being HIGHER as the spacecraft approaches you, dropping and going LOWER than the nominal frequency as it recedes from you. The amount of shift increases with both the velocity and the frequency of the signal in question. On AO-40 Doppler can be as high as 30 KHz on S band.

What is a heartbeat?
FAQThe xAP protocol specifies a special control message, called a heartbeat. Wherever possible, xAP enabled devices and applications are encourage to broadcast this message periodically to provide a network-wide indication of system health. The heartbeat interval is defined at the discretion of the application developer - it is typically of the order of a 15 secs-5 mins depending on the application. xAP promotes the use of regular heartbeats.
Why so early? What dental problems could a baby have?
HeaderThe most important reason is to begin a thorough prevention program. Dental problems can begin early. A big concern is Early Childhood Caries (also know as baby bottle tooth decay or nursing caries). Your child risks severe decay from using a bottle during naps or at night or when they nurse continuously from the breast. The earlier the dental visit, the better the chance of preventing dental problems.
